There’s been no shortage of interest in the top of the ticket in the 2020 election, but there’s much at stake down ticket as well at the state level. Shareholders Sarah Mercer and Brin Gibson from the firm’s State & Local Legislation & Policy Group break down races to watch at the gubernatorial, attorney general and state legislature level that could also have a big impact.
